Output 7274dd171613aa6eaa5de9567c52de347307fb7f113688473520e4302465c296:8

value
2939452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c3c93786487965719c045866802362e89be2283 OP_EQUAL
address
32oibk6cAaRtu7AGRqRp5PLxawyoiyfdYG
transaction
7274dd171613aa6eaa5de9567c52de347307fb7f113688473520e4302465c296
confirmations
257320
spent
true